Overview
KEMET U2J dielectric features a maximum operating
temperature of 125°C and is considered stable. The
Electronics Industries Alliance (EIA) characterizes U2J
dielectric as a Class I material. Components of this
classification are temperature compensating and are
suited for resonant circuit applications or those where Q
and stability of capacitance characteristics are required.
U2J is an extremely stable dielectric material that exhibits
a negligible shift in capacitance with respect to voltage
and boasts a predictable and linear change in capacitance
with reference to ambient temperature with no aging
effect. In addition, U2J dielectric extends the available
capacitance range of Class I MLCCs to achieve values
previously only available using Class II dielectric materials
like X7R, X5R, Y5V and Z5U.
U2J is not sensitive to DC Bias as compared to Class
II dielectric materials and retains over 99% of nominal
capacitance at full rated voltage. KEMET automotive grade
capacitors meet the demanding Automotive Electronics
Council's AEC–Q200 qualification requirements.
Capacitance change is limited to −750 ±120 ppm/°C from
−55°C to +125°C. These devices are lead (Pb)-free, RoHS
and REACH compliant without exception and are capable
of withstanding multiple passes through a lead (Pb)-free
solder reflow profile.
Benefits
• AEC–Q200 automotive qualified
• Up to 10x increase in capacitance versus C0G
• Extremely low effective series resistance (ESR)
• Extremely low effective series inductance (ESL)
• High ripple current capability
• Low noise solution similar to C0G
• Retains over 99% of nominal capacitance at full rated voltage
• Small predictable and linear capacitance change with respect
to temperature
• Operating temperature range of −55°C to +125°C
• Capacitance up to 470 nF
• DC voltage ratings up to 50 V
